December 28, 1998'Botts Dots' Make a Friendly Bump in the Night
It鈥檚 a dark night, it鈥檚 drizzling and you鈥檙e approaching a foreboding curve with various looming undulations of landscape on both sides of the road. Your eyes focus on the brightly shining reflectors running along the centerline of the narrow highway. If the reflectors weren鈥檛 there to catch your headlight beams, if they weren鈥檛 evenly spaced to mark the coming route like stitches on the planet鈥檚 crust, you鈥檇 probably feel uneasy. Without them to point the way, you could find yourself hurtling off the dark asphalt.

December 28, 1998EPA Refutes Engine Makers' Claims
The Environmental Protection Agency flatly denied claims by the nation鈥檚 largest diesel engine manufacturers that they had warned the agency in 1994 that its pollution tests were flawed and didn鈥檛 properly measure engine emissions.

December 23, 1998STB Extends Rate Bureau Authority
The Surface Transportation Board extended for one year the authority of motor carrier rate bureaus to set rates and the National Classification Committee to establish commodity classes for freight moving by truck.
